Chapter 95: Minions Have Reached the Tower

Translator: EndlessFantasy Translation Editor: EndlessFantasy Translation

There was a thought all along that LoL matches should also have a half-ti. This was to alleviate the tension from both teams in these matches, while also giving them ti to regroup with the team and discuss further strategies for the match.

However, there wasn’t any rules for a break in the ga, so they made it themselves—manual pause.

That’s to say, players would do things like kick out the internet cable, scream that the computer was lagging or that the screen froze midway, press R and state that their Q is not working... the list goes on.

The bottom line was, Huang Yu had made a great choice unknowingly, which was accidentally kicking the cable out of anger once he had gotten thrashed at mid lane. This allowed a short reprieve from the opponent’s constant barrage of attacks which had been snow-balling the lane.

***

“I’m sorry, everyone,” Huang Yu said dejectedly.

In this tournant, he had already ssed up and let his team endure a 4 vs 5 in the first match. Now in the final match, although he was the team’s captain, he kept getting wrecked.

“We don’t bla you, that Fizz is really too good.” Yin Qin replied calmly.

Yu Luocheng nodded his head in agreent. From the mont Fizz had started farming, he could already tell that this player was so much better than Huang Yu in terms of skills. Not only was he skilled, he also had the support of a great jungler. Huang Yu was basically forced to face two semi-pro players in this match up alone.

Also, due to Xiao Dao’s Jarvan being killed the few tis he chose to gank, he was already behind in terms of gold earned. He had no choice but to give up on mid lane and help out more at the top and bottom lanes. Even by doing so, he was still lagging behind in items as compared to the opponent jungler.

“The host had also revealed the opponent mid-laner’s information just now. He really is one of the top ten in the LoL University League.” Yin Qin recapped.

“How can they be so good? They aren’t even professionals but we’re being pressured until there’s nothing we can do.” Huang Yu said helplessly.

Huang Yu Wong rarely t such good adversaries, especially ones that could retaliate so strongly even after he had gained the advantage of first blood. He was even killed under his own tower! Was this what players from the top ten in the LoL University League were capable of?

Team Scarlet’s goal was to be professional players aiming to join the LPL tournant. But now, a semi-pro player from the University League was already giving them such a problem and this was a huge blow to their confidence. How were they supposed to win this match?

“Maybe you can try to force a team fight. Before Fizz returns to the mid lane, their team should be slightly weaker.” Yin Qin suggested.

Yu Luocheng shook his head. “We can’t.”

In terms of team fighting, Jayce’s crowd control was better than Fizz. Without his items however, it would not be enough. If they initiated a team fight, all Volibear had to do was just stand in front and take the damage and Jayce would be rendered useless. More importantly, their top lane Singed was not developed enough yet. Forcing a team fight too early would make Singed’s use in a team fight lower.

“Xiao Tongtong, play your Singed a bit more unconventionally.” Yu Luocheng said. “Try to attract their jungler’s attention as much as you can. Best if you go for Proxy Farming.”

“Proxy farming? Are you sure?” Xiao Tongtong asked.

“Yeah. Even if you get caught and die, you won’t lose out on that much gold. Basically you need to hurry back to your lane and give Riven and Volibear so kills. It’s better than letting them demolish it the whole way.”

***

After Huang Yu’s computer cable was reconnected, the players returned to their seats. As the big screen entered into a countdown, the players got ready to re-enter the match. As per Yu Luocheng’s suggested strategy of playing unconventionally, Xiao Tongtong tried to attract Fizz and Volibear’s attention.

What is proxy farming?

It requires a champion to run past the opponent’s first tower, killing all the minions in between the first and second tower. This tactic is similar to dangling a piece of at in front of a bunch of hungry dogs.

In short—asking for it!

Xiao Tongtong’s play with Singed had the audience pointing and murmuring about it. If this had been done during normal matches or qualifying matches, it was usually by egoistic n who put on airs to show off!

***

“Yang Ying, the Singed is Proxy Farming. Should we chase after him? Mid lane’s Jayce is not worth much now anyway.” Lin Laowu asked.

“No, let him be,” Yang Ying said carelessly. “We’ll go to the bottom lane and pressure them instead.”

***

Singed had almost broken through, and yet there was no one who cared to stop him at the top lane. From the map, you could see that Fizz and Volibear had gone down to the bottom lane a few tis, and had even invaded their jungle area.

“They’re not taking the bait...” Xiao Tongtong said, a little worried. He was basically stripteasing next to the tower, and still, no one bothered about him. Was this really a good strategy?

“They’re smart. They’ve already planned on forcing us into a team fight.” Yu Luocheng stated, frowning.

If they forced a team fight, the top lane wouldn’t be able to assist them. Jayce’s items were still incomplete, Jarvan didn’t have enough health to tank, this would result in a complete loss!

***

“Shit, they’re going to tower dive!” Xue Haiyang exclaid loudly.

Fizz and Volibear had made their way to the bottom lane, cutting off Yu Luocheng and Xue Haiyang’s escape route from the back. This effectively trapped them under their own tower.

There were wolves in front and tigers at the back!

Yu Luocheng’s Lux and Xue Haiyang’s Caitlyn were stranded under the tower and were suddenly having to face four of the opposing champions. A cannon minion was nearing their tower, and they would definitely use the ti when the tower was focusing on the cannon minion to launch their attack.

The minions had reached the tower, and four of the opponents had the tower surrounded. There was only Lux and Caitlyn to defend the tower.

“Xiao Dao, Huang Yu, don’t bother coming over! Just focus on pushing their mid lane tower!” Yu Luocheng instructed the rest of the team.

Even if the two of them ca down to assist, they wouldn’t make it on ti. Furthermore, as their items were not completed, they would just co to die at the bottom lane. The bush behind the tower had a ward which revealed Fizz and Volibear inside.

Fizz was already holding up his trident, waiting to dash out at any ti to claim the heads of Lux and Caitlyn. Volibear was grinning and rubbing his paws together, eyes gleaming with beastly excitent. He clearly couldn’t wait to smash the two female champions that were trapped under the tower.

“Xue Haiyang, when I count to three, Flash and use your E to run. Keep running and don’t look back!” Yu Luocheng said solemnly.

“But what about you?”

“Three!” Yu Luocheng ignored him, starting his count.

“Two!”

“One!”
